Olumide Akpata, a former Labour Party (LP) candidate for governor of Edo State, has described how he and other African Democratic Party (ADC) officials, including Peter Obi, a 2027 presidential candidate, managed to avoid death in Benin City during the week.

After suspected assassins attacked an ADC gathering in Edo State, it was stated that former Anambra State Governor Peter Obi’s motorcade was peppered with gunfire.

During Akpata’s official admission into the African Democratic Congress (ADC) in Benin City, Obi and others were attacked.

According to Akpata, who recounted the events, “The transportation of some of us to ADC was scheduled for 11 o’clock on that specific day.

However, it occurred around one o’clock. Additionally, we received information from typically trustworthy sources that the ADC Secretariat would be attacked.

We are therefore instructed to expedite our function. We therefore made an effort to go as fast as we could. After that, we left the building and went to Chief John Oyegun’s home in the GRA. When we arrived, we were informed that the ADC Secretariat had been assaulted as soon as we had left.

It’s true that I brought my relatives along. My companions had accompanied me. A few of them suffered injuries. In fact, one relative had a bottle smashed on her head. Therefore, it wasn’t a question of them saying, “I have first-hand information regarding…” and being really believable based on what transpired that day.

“We were snapping pictures and talking outside Oyegun’s front door when we noticed what appeared to be a double drive by. Some individuals were passing the home and began shooting. The entrance door and the gates are therefore somewhat of a distance apart.

“There is a driveway, but the shooting was so intense that the SSS, DSS, and men who were with us had to push us back into the sitting room. We stayed there for another twenty minutes until the attackers had left, at which point we went outside to look at the damage and all of the cars that were there.

“I have no doubt that people would have perished if they had been seated in those cars. You could see the gates, the bullet wounds, and everything else.” That’s what transpired that day.

“I disagree with your assertion that the Edo state government said this was an intraparty issue. I don’t think many people will believe that the problems at the ADC the day before, which involved people I know personally and am quite familiar with, won’t lead to armed guys coming to the center of GRA in the afternoon and firing weapons.

“In my opinion, it is merely a warning to voters that they should stay at home since participating in this process will put their lives in peril. People become unwilling to participate, which is an attack on democracy.
